    Security updates for Friday
    Security updates have been issued by Debian (agg, golang-1.7, golang-1.8, mariadb-10.0, and postgis), Fedora (kernel, kernel-headers, and kernel-tools), Mageia (gitolite and libvorbis), openSUSE (pdns-recursor and webkit2gtk3), Oracle (firefox, ghostscript, kernel, polkit, spice, and spice-server), Red Hat (etcd, ghostscript, polkit, spice, and spice-server), Scientific Linux (ghostscript, polkit, spice, and spice-server), SUSE (python3), and Ubuntu (libvncserver).

    The GNU C Library version 2.29 is now available
    Version 2.29 of the GNU C
    library
    (glibc) is now available. It includes a wrapper for the getcpu()
    system call
    , optimized generic versions of multiple math functions
    (e.g. exp(), log2(), sinf()), new functions to
    allow posix_spawn() to run the new process in a different
    directory, and more.

    [$] Rusty's reminiscences
    Rusty Russell was one of the first developers paid to work on the Linux
    kernel and the founder of the conference now known as linux.conf.au (LCA); he is
    one of the most highly respected figures in the Australian free-software
    community. The 2019 LCA was the
    20th edition of this long-lived event; the organizers felt that it was an
    appropriate time to invite Russell to deliver the closing keynote talk.
    He used the opportunity to review his path into free software and the
    creation of LCA, but first a change of clothing was required.
